Lou Schwartzkopf of the Physics Department at Minnesota State University, Mankato will present a lecture "Is Energy Independence for Minnesota Possible?" If Minnesota is to become energy-independent, it must replace its imported energy from fossil fuels with homegrown renewable energy -- wind for electricity, ethanol for transportation, and biogas for natural gas. This talk will include calculations to show how much of these renewable energy resources will be needed to achieve energy independence. It will also be shown how we can meet our increasing need for electricity without relying on new coal-fired power plants.
